400 tons of brome and or prairie hay. Delivered once a month, Nov. 1 st , Dec. 1st, Jan. 1st , Feb. 1st , at 100 tons per month. • 200 tons of alfalfa hay. Delivered once a month, Nov. 1 st , Dec. 1st, Jan. 1st , Feb. 1st , at 50 tons per month. • The Business of Land Management requires all hay to have a minimum crude protein content: • Alfalfa-12% • Smooth Brome-10% • Grass-6% • Delivered hay must be produced from current-year or prior-year crops, with leafy, well-cured, properly stored, and free from dust, mold, excessive heat, or other weather-related damage. • No Russian Thistle or prickly herb, “Cheat” grass, sandburs, grass burs, noxious weed, or grass not considered healthy. • Hay must not have any bearded grain or any forage plant containing long awns (spikelets). • Free of any blister beetles.
